Is it necessary to have personal automobile insurance in order to use Communauto s vehicles?

0

No. When you use one of our cars you are automatically covered by Communauto s insurance; it is included in our rates. In the case of an accident, your liability is limited to the deductible you select upon signing the Contract, i.e. $0, $250 or $500 per accident. Usually, no deductible is billed if you are not at fault for the accident.
